Easy to manoeuvre

When you are shopping for strollers, it is crucial to think about how it is easy to maneuver them. The majority of strollers are designed be easily maneuverable, so they can be pushed through narrow aisles in stores and navigate through busy sidewalks. A lightweight, easy to move stroller will make your life easier whether you're taking an outing on the streets, running errands or taking a walk.

A stroller with three wheels is the perfect choice for small spaces and crowded streets. It can be steered in any direction, which means you can navigate through the most chaotic of situations. A majority of strollers come with an front-wheel that can be turned making it easier to maneuver around tight spaces.

When you are choosing a stroller you should also consider how it will perform on different terrains. A 3 wheel parent facing pushchair-wheeled stroller is good for bumpy sidewalks but not so on steep hills or escalators. This is due to the fact that the single front wheel is easily clogged with grass, stones or other debris. A stroller with four wheels is more stable and less likely to tip over when navigating steep slopes or escalators.

A jogging or 3-wheel stroller is a great choice for parents who wish to exercise with their children. These strollers feature large rear wheels as well as an adjustable lockable front wheel that makes them easy to move around. These strollers can be used for jogging on rough or uneven terrain, like gravel roads and trails. If you plan to make use of your stroller for a jogger, select one that has rubber air or foam filled tires for the best 3 wheel bassinet stroller wheel Buggy - Https://www.play56.net/ - ride.

It is important to know that although the majority of strollers can be used on stairs or escalators, it is not recommended. Stroller injuries are most often caused by falls on escalators and stairs. This could be hazardous for your child. If you have to utilize an escalator or stairs, it is recommended to have someone with you who can help you lift the stroller up or down.
